        <p>Let H be a graph and ẞ  be an H-decomposition of G. The H-magic total labeling of a graph G is an assignment of integers set [1, |V(G)∪E(G)|]  to V(G)∪E(G)  such that: any vertex and any edge of G receive distinct integers, and the sum of all vertices receive integers and all edges receive integers on B is a constant for any B ∈ ẞ.  In this paper we study the H-super magic problems of balanced incomplete block designs and resolvable balanced incomplete block designs. </p>
